创建ClusterIssuer
- 创建请求
[root@master01 test]# vim clusterissuer-letsencrypt-prod.yaml
apiVersion: cert-manager.io/v1
kind: ClusterIssuer
metadata:
name: letsencrypt-issuer-prod
spec:
acme:
email: x120952576@126.com
server: https://acme-v02.api.letsencrypt.org/directory
privateKeySecretRef:
name: letsencrypt-accountkey-prod
solvers:
- http01:
ingress:
ingressClassName: nginx
[root@master01 test]# kubectl apply -f clusterissuer-letsencrypt-prod.yaml
- 确认验证
[root@master01 test]# kubectl get clusterissuer
NAME READY AGE
letsencrypt-issuer-prod True 4s
[root@master01 test]# kubectl describe clusterissuers.cert-manager.io letsencrypt-issuer-prod
证书使用
方式一:证书注解申请
配置 ingress调用从 ingress-shim 自动创建的 Certificate ,采用注解的方式,直接一步到位,省去了些证书申请的过程。
- 配置ingress
主要配置ingress部分。
[root@master01 test]# vim test-spring-demo.yaml
---
apiVersion: apps/v1
kind: Deployment
metadata:
name: hello-spring-dp
namespace: test
spec:
selector:
matchLabels:
name: hello-spring
template:
metadata:
name: hello-spring
labels:
name: hello-spring
spec:
containers:
- name: hello-spring
image: registry.cn-hangzhou.aliyuncs.com/xhyimages/hello-spring:v1.0.0
ports:
- containerPort: 8080
---
apiVersion: v1
kind: Service
metadata:
name: hello-spring-svc
namespace: test
spec:
selector:
name: hello-spring
ports:
- port: 80
targetPort: 8080
---
apiVersion: networking.k8s.io/v1
kind: Ingress
metadata:
name: hello-spring-ingress
namespace: test
annotations:
cert-manager.io/cluster-issuer: letsencrypt-issuer-prod # 新增调用issuer的注解
cert-manager.io/duration: 2160h
cert-manager.io/renew-before: 240h
cert-manager.io/private-key-algorithm: RSA
cert-manager.io/private-key-size: "2048"
cert-manager.io/private-key-rotation-policy: Always
spec:
ingressClassName: nginx
tls: # 配置 TLS
- hosts:
- spring.linuxsb.com # 指定域名
secretName: spring-linuxsb-com-tls # 配置secret名称
rules:
- host: spring.linuxsb.com
http:
paths:
- path: /
pathType: Prefix
backend:
service:
name: hello-spring-svc
port:
number: 80
释义:
如上注解主要是实现:
- cert-manager 注解:告诉 ingress-shim 用哪个 ClusterIssuer
- tls 配置:告诉它证书域名和 Secret 名称

方式二:证书手动申请
如果ingress已存在,或者不方便修改ingress注解,可独立创建证书申请,然后ingress中引用即可。
- 创建证书申请
[root@master01 test]# vim certificate-spring-linuxsb-com.yaml
apiVersion: cert-manager.io/v1
kind: Certificate
metadata:
name: hello-spring-certificate
namespace: test
spec:
secretName: spring-linuxsb-com-tls
issuerRef:
name: letsencrypt-issuer-prod
kind: ClusterIssuer
group: cert-manager.io
dnsNames:
- spring.linuxsb.com
duration: 2160h # 90天
renewBefore: 240h # 提前10天续期
privateKey:
algorithm: RSA
size: 2048
rotationPolicy: Always
usages:
- digital signature
- key encipherment
- server auth
[root@master01 test]# kubectl apply -f certificate-spring-linuxsb-com.yaml

- 两种区别
| 对比项 | Ingress 注解方式 | 显式 Certificate 方式 |
|---|---|---|
| 证书触发入口 | Ingress | Certificate |
| 是否需要手工写 Certificate | 否 | 是 |
| Ingress 是否承担证书元数据 | 是 | 否 |
| 配置清晰度 | 中 | 高 |
| 自动化便捷性 | 高 | 中 |
| GitOps 可控性 | 中 | 高 |
| 排障可读性 | 中 | 高 |
| 适合场景 | 简单网站、快速接入 | 生产标准化、平台化 |
